Understanding Switch Types for Tablets
Switch types refer to the mechanisms that activate buttons or keys on your tablet, affecting tactile feedback, noise levels, and responsiveness. The main types include membrane, mechanical, and hybrid switches. Each offers distinct benefits suited for different uses.
Membrane Switches
Membrane switches are common in many tablets due to their low cost and quiet operation. They use pressure pads that complete a circuit when pressed. While they provide a soft feel, they may lack the tactile feedback preferred by gamers and power users.
Mechanical Switches
Mechanical switches offer a distinct tactile response, making them popular among gamers and productivity enthusiasts. They use individual mechanical parts for each key press, providing durability and precise feedback. In 2026, advanced mechanical switches feature customizable actuation points and sound dampening options.
Hybrid Switches
Hybrid switches combine elements of membrane and mechanical designs. They aim to deliver the tactile feedback of mechanical switches while maintaining a quieter operation. These are ideal for users who need versatility in their tablet experience.
Feel and Feedback for Gaming and Productivity
The feel of a switch impacts how comfortable and effective your interaction is. In 2026, the focus is on customizable feedback, including adjustable actuation points, sound dampening, and haptic feedback. These features allow users to tailor their experience for gaming precision or prolonged productivity sessions.
Tactile Feedback
Tactile feedback provides a physical response when a switch is activated. It helps users confirm their input without needing to look at the screen. High-quality mechanical switches with pronounced tactile bumps are preferred for gaming and typing accuracy.
Sound Levels
Sound dampening is increasingly important in shared spaces. Quiet switches, often with built-in dampening materials, are ideal for environments where noise could be disruptive. In 2026, new switch designs focus on balancing feedback with minimal noise.
Choosing the Right Switch for Your Needs
Selecting the appropriate switch type depends on your primary use case. Gamers may prefer mechanical switches with high responsiveness, while productivity users might opt for hybrid or membrane switches for quieter, more comfortable typing. Consider also the feel and feedback that best suits your hand and style.
- For gaming: Mechanical switches with fast actuation and pronounced tactile feedback.
- For productivity: Hybrid switches or membrane switches with quiet operation and comfortable feel.
- For shared spaces: Switches with sound dampening and minimal noise.
